Título:
Test for the air-purification performance of semiconducting photocatalytic materials determined in concordance with ISO 22197- 1:2007 Part 1: Removal of nitric oxide

Descripción:
The air-purification experiments on 6 photocatalyitic concrete stones provided by Pavimentos de Tudela S.L. were performed from the 18th January 2010 till the 28th January 2010. The conducting tests were executed by Dr. Maria de los Milagros Ballari and were supervised by Prof. Dr. Jos Brouwers. The experiments were performed according to the standard ISO 22197-1:2007 for the nitric oxide (NO) removal and they included a pretreatment of the samples (removal of organic matter and washing with water), the pollutant removal test and the elution test. The photocatalytic pollutant removal test took about 8 hours per sample as the samples had to be photoirradiated for 5 hours. The inlet NO concentration was stabilized during 20 minutes previous to the starting point of the experiments. Subsequently, the by-pass valve to the reactor was opened allowing the test gas to flow into the photoreactor. The previous step was performed in the complete absence of photoirradiation. After 30 min, the sample was irradiated for 5 hours. Finally, the pollutant source was stopped and the UV radiation was switched off and the NOx concentration was recorded during 30 minutes. The elution test included the water volume record and the pH measurement, but it did not include the nitrate/nitrite concentration determination. During the total time of the experiments, the laboratory temperature was 22.5 ºC ± 2.5 ºC and the relative humidity was determined to be 50% ± 2%.
